Racetracks near Los Angeles
Anyone know of a good racetrack near LA? I live in thousand Oaks and I'm having trouble finding a good track. I wanna go to Laguna Seca but that will cost me 15k to reserve a date.

There's California Speedway in Fontana, there is (or used to be) stuff in Pomona and Riverside, Buttonwillow is just over the Grape Vine right off of 5, There used to also be something just outside Lancaster but that was a while ago and I don't remember the name. Go through any old Car magazines you have. Most of those are based in SoCal and do a lot of their track testing in and around the LA area. San Diego is home for me (though living in Italy right now) and we used to go to Riverside for stuff and they used to have a nice road course. Oh yeah, also used to be a small road course in Carlsbad (San Diego) but with all the development in that area I'm not sure if it is still there. Another good place to check is with SCCA...they run events all over the place. If you're ever in San Diego, they do a great event at Qualcom Stadium. Check their website for locations. I'm sure there is some type of autocross events going on in LA on a frequent basis. If you're looking for an excuse to get to mVegas there is a course outside Pharump (Just north of Vegas) and stuff at Las Vegas Motor Speedway. Hope you find what you're looking for.
